当前位置: 首页 > web >正文

配置Nginx启用Https

本文主要介绍了在内网环境下、服务主机无域名的情况下,配置Nginx启用HTTPS的方法。服务主机操作系统为麒麟V10 SP3。

1. 安装 Nginx(如果未安装)

sudo yum install -y nginx
或(如果 yum 不可用):bash
sudo dnf install -y nginx
启动并设置开机自启:bash
sudo systemctl start nginx
sudo systemctl enable nginx

2. 生成自签名证书(无域名)

由于是内网环境,使用 OpenSSL 生成自签名证书:

# 创建 SSL 目录
sudo mkdir -p /etc/nginx/ssl
cd /etc/nginx/ssl# 生成私钥(RSA 2048)
sudo openssl genrsa -out server.key 2048# 生成自签名证书(CN 可设为服务器IP或任意名称)
sudo openssl req -x509 -new -nodes -key server.key \-subj "/CN=192.168.1.100" -days 3650 -out server.crt
/CN=192.168.1.100 可替换为服务器内网 IP 或自
http://www.xdnf.cn/news/6012.html

相关文章:

  • 豌豆 760 收录泛滥现象深度解析与应对策略
  • FedTracker:为联邦学习模型提供所有权验证和可追溯性
  • Unity3D 序列化机制:引擎内的应用场景和基本原理
  • vue3项目创建-配置-elementPlus导入-路由自动导入
  • 江苏发改委回复:分时电价调整对储能项目的影响 源网荷储一体化能量管理系统储能EMS
  • 为什么企业建站或独立站选用WordPress
  • C程序的存储空间分配
  • 汉得 x 真味生物|H-ZERO PaaS项目启动,共启数字化新征程!
  • 可视化+智能补全:用Database Tool重塑数据库工作流
  • java 结合 FreeMarker 和 Docx4j 来生成包含图片的 docx 文件
  • 七、深入 Hive DDL:管理表、分区与洞察元数据
  • 邀请函|PostgreSQL培训认证报名正式开启
  • 演员评论家算法
  • LS-DYNA一箭穿心仿真分析
  • Oracle CDB 与 Non-CDB (NoCDB) 的区别
  • Linux(1)编译链接和gcc
  • typedef unsigned short uint16_t; typedef unsigned int uint32_t;
  • Lin4neuro 系统详解
  • Qt应用程序启动时的一些思路:从单实例到性能优化的处理方案
  • zabbix最新版本7.2超级详细安装部署(一)
  • VS Code怎么设置python SDK路径
  • 理解计算机系统_并发编程(5)_基于线程的并发(二):线程api和基于线程的并发服务器
  • Ascend的aclgraph(六)AclConcreteGraph
  • 技术并不能产生一个好的产品
  • solidwors插件 开发————仙盟创梦IDE
  • # YOLOv3:基于 PyTorch 的目标检测模型实现
  • 2.7/Q2,Charls最新文章解读
  • 北三短报文数传终端:筑牢水利防汛“智慧防线”,守护江河安澜
  • 构建你的第一个简单AI助手 - 入门实践
  • LangSmith 基本使用教程